Rochester Care Home provides residential personal care and support for up to 56 older people, with the Napier Unit offering respite care for up to eight people with complex physical and learning disabilities. At inspection, 53 residents lived in the home across four separate wings, and six people were on respite stays. People, relatives and staff described the service as exceptionally well-led. The registered manager led by example and promoted an open, inclusive culture where residents, families and staff were all valued for their individuality.
Source: CQC inspection report, 9 October 2019
